Czystość i Konserwacja

8.5
  • Housekeeping: Generally reliable, though some guests report missed days or 'forgotten' requests for towels.
  • Bathroom hygiene: Mostly sparkling, but isolated reports of 'weed smell' in suites and limited sink counter space.
  • Maintenance: Modern and new, but watch out for finicky thermostats and the occasional broken motion light.
  • Linens & towels: Standard Hyatt quality—clean and crisp, though pillows are frequently described as 'flat'.
  • Odors & scents: Lobby smells fresh; hallways usually clean, though marijuana smoke from other guests is a common urban complaint.

Zanim zarezerwujesz

Warto wiedzieć

  • The pool is heated and open year-round, a rarity for outdoor pools in Memphis.
  • Motion-sensor lights under the bed can't be turned off and may wake you up if you toss and turn.
  • Breakfast at CIMAS is not free and can be slow; grab coffee at the 'Crazy Gander' nearby instead.

Is there a resort fee?

No specific 'resort fee' is currently listed, but a 'Destination Fee' of ~$25 may appear at booking; verify inclusions at check-in as policies fluctuate.

Is the pool heated?

Yes, the outdoor pool is heated and technically open year-round, though it can be chilly in deep winter.

Can I self-park?

Not at the hotel. Valet is ~$36/night. You can self-park at the 210 Wagner Place lot (~$11) or other nearby garages if you don't mind walking.

Is it noisy?

Yes. You are sandwiched between a party street and a train track. Request a high floor to mitigate this.

Do the rooms have desks?

Not all of them. Many standard rooms replaced the desk with a lounge chair. If you need to work, call ahead to confirm your room type.

Is it pet friendly?

Yes, dogs up to 50lbs are welcome for a $100 fee (1-6 nights) or $200 (7+ nights).
